A new Pacific Northwest National Laboratory (PNNL) study shows finds that oil from algae grown in outdoor raceway ponds located in the Gulf Coast, the Southeastern Seaboard and the Great Lakes could replace 17% of the United States’ imported oil for transportation. The paper is published in the journal Water Resources Research.

Mexico President Felipe Calderon today announced PEMEX’ first oil discovery in the deepwater Gulf of Mexico. The state-owned company’s Trion 1 well, 177 km off the coast of Tamaulipas, confirmed the presence of lightoil reservoirs in the province of the Perdido fold belt. Bosch is starting volume production of a new drive unit consisting of an electric motor and an integrated inverter for light commercial vehicles. By embedding the electric drive module in the vehicles’ existing water-cooling circuit, an oil-based cooling circuit is no longer necessary.

By making use of a previously undesired side effect in oil recovery, researchers at Tokyo University of Agriculture and Technology (TUAT) have developed a method that yields up to 20% more heavy oil than traditional methods. Generally, less than 10% of heavy oil may be produced from reservoirs by natural flow after drilling the well.
Begun in December 2007, development of the Pazflor oil field 150 kilometers (93 miles) offshore Angola is one of the biggest projects currently operated by Total. The Pazflor oil field comprises four reservoirs. One of them, Acacia, was formed around 25 million years ago in the Oligocene and contains lightoil.

Pyrolysis bio-oils are produced by the thermal decomposition of biomass by heating in the absence of oxygen at more than 500 °C; fast pyrolysis of biomass is much less expensive than biomass conversion technologies based on gasification or fermentation processes. Rice University researchers are taking advantage of graphene’s outstanding strength, light weight and solubility to enhance fluids used to drill oil wells. When the drill bit is removed and drilling fluid displaced, the formation oil forces remnants of the filter cake out of the pores as the well begins to produce.
The Nonox emulsion combustion unit (ECU) is a complete emulsion fuel system containing the mixing chamber and fuel/water proportioning controls. The Nonox proprietary cavitation reactor chamber contains no moving parts and delivers an even dispersion of correctly-sized water particles throughout the emulsion.

Findings by MIT researchers could help advance the commercialization of supercritical water technology for the desulfurization and upgrading of high-sulfur crude oil into high-value, cleaner fuels such as gasoline without using hydrogen—a major change in refining technology that would reduce costs, energy use, and CO 2 emissions.

The Bakken is a prime US unconventional oil play, and is believed to be one of the largest, if not the largest, oil accumulation in the US. The tight oil is extracted in the same way as shale gas, through horizontal wells and hydraulic fracturing. In the Bakken formation, the oil is extracted from tight carbonate.

Shale oil production generates greenhouse gas emissions at levels similar to conventional crude oil production, according to a pair of new studies released by the US Department of Energy’s Argonne National Laboratory. These are shale formations with low permeability and must be hydraulically fractured to produce oil and gas.
